The husband-and-wife time of Kevin and Jackie Freiberg offer up a book filled with leadership advice built around stories of successful companies ranging from SAS to Whole Foods, Southwest Airlines to Synovus.
In general, I'm skeptical of business books which profile large companies written by people who have never run a large company. First, there's the "do as I say, not as I do (or have done)" credibility gap. And second, this genre tends to attribute too much of a company's overall success or failure to a single personality. Having said that, I think the Freibergs have done a decent job of wrapping their high-level advice (e.g., create a sense of ownership, lead with love, make business heroic) around stories and interviews that are engaging, well-written, and carefully selected to make their point. And it's always intriguing to learn how a name-brand organization got its start. On the other hand, be prepared for some dramatic (over-?)simplification of complex realities. The company case studies are less case studies and more one-dimensional illustrations the authors carefully package to make the point they want to make. Sometimes it feels just a little glib, as in "let me tell you this cute story that just so happens to illustrate the general leadership principle I'm pushing in this chapter." My favorite chapter was about how gutsy leaders lead with love. As a person of faith, I find the idea of servant leadership (popularized by authors such as Robert Greenleaf and Peter Vail) powerful and resonant with my own religious beliefs. I also enjoyed the chapter on how effective leaders tie their organization's mission to a heroic cause. To illustrate this point, the authors tell the story of how one teacher's (Sandra McBrayer) heroic vision to teach homeless kids galvanized the San Diego community to build an entire school for disdvantaged kids called Monarch High School (complete with its own restaurant created with the help of Ralph Rubio, cofounder and CEO of Rubio's Fresh Mexican Grill). The book is visually attractive -- not quite as arresting as Tom Peter's new book called "Re-imagine!", but the layout, color, pull quotes, and photos call attention to the main points well. Overall, it's worth a quick read for some interesting stories and a few ideas to consider as you think about how to improve your own organization's culture.
